The role

As a Commercial Counsel in Legora’s London office, you will play a central role in supporting one of the fastest-growing legal technology companies globally. You will work closely with our commercial teams, advising on a broad range of matters with a primary focus on drafting and negotiating commercial contracts.

This role requires a high degree of independence and the ability to operate across multiple time zones, partnering closely with stakeholders to enable deals while managing risk. You will report to the General Counsel, based at our Stockholm headquarters.

Legora’s legal function is a forward-deployed, AI-first team working across multiple jurisdictions and legal disciplines. We act as trusted partners to the business, with particular focus on product development, operations, and commercial initiatives. Beyond strong legal judgment, we value curiosity, problem-solving, and a proactive mindset — looking for pragmatic solutions as we help redefine how legal work is done globally.

What you will be doing:

  • Act as a commercial legal partner to the business, working closely with senior stakeholders in Growth, Operations, and Procurement on customer and supplier engagements.

  • Lead the drafting, review, and negotiation of customer and supplier contracts, with a strong focus on closing deals efficiently and pragmatically.

  • Advise on commercial risk allocation, pricing structures, liability, and contractual protections within customer and supplier agreements.

  • Support go-to-market and procurement activities by enabling scalable, repeatable commercial contracting practices.

  • Address data protection and compliance considerations primarily within the context of customer and supplier contracts, ensuring risks are appropriately managed without slowing execution.

  • Develop and maintain commercial templates, playbooks, and guidelines to standardise negotiations and improve deal velocity.
